Output 96bc1d3be64dc544ecc637d5e99f897bb90dc6c78c41dcdcecfe032b0f8b381e:18

value
56230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a28256457a220667dec9353fd338fb75298e367a OP_EQUAL
address
3GWHXbPFqHnNahdCJYv5Ydh1HQvgaesV6e
transaction
96bc1d3be64dc544ecc637d5e99f897bb90dc6c78c41dcdcecfe032b0f8b381e
confirmations
193848
spent
true